A Ground Report on Shaheen Bagh What was the Shaheen Bagh protest? -By Zeeshan Akhtar The Shaheen Bagh protest came into existence on 15th December 2019 when a group of 10-15 females decided to start a sit-in protest by blockading the Kalindi-Kunj Road which is a six-lane highway. As more and more people started joining the protest (especially women) it started attracting media and political attention. Few days into the protest more and more people started supporting the cause, which was to oppose the CAA (Citizenship Amendment Act 2019) which was passed by the BJP government as well as Shaheen Bagh was a voice against NPR, NRC, unemployment, poverty, women safety and police brutality. Shaheen Bagh was a leaderless protest which was started by (mostly) Muslim woman, and this was one of the major qualities of this protest as it was not influenced by any political party or a local leader.
